使用 GroupDocs.Conversion for .NET 将 PPSM 转换为 LaTeX:分步指南
介绍
您需要将 PowerPoint 幻灯片 (PPSM) 文件转换为 LaTeX 文档吗?无论是学术论文还是技术文档,将演示文稿集成到 LaTeX 中都可以提高文档的准确性和格式。本教程将指导您使用 GroupDocs.Conversion for .NET 轻松将 PPSM 文件转换为 TEX 格式。
您将学到什么:
- 使用 GroupDocs.Conversion 将 PPSM 文件转换为 TEX 的基础知识
- 使用必要的工具和库设置您的环境
- 逐步实施转换过程
在我们开始转换之旅之前,首先要确保您已满足所有先决条件。
先决条件
开始之前,请确保您已准备好以下内容:
所需库:
- GroupDocs.Conversion for .NET (版本 25.3.0)
环境设置要求:
- 支持 C#(.NET Framework 或 .NET Core)的开发环境
- 对 C# 编程有基本的了解
- 熟悉操作系统中的文件路径和目录结构
为 .NET 设置 GroupDocs.Conversion
首先,安装 GroupDocs.转换 使用 NuGet 包管理器或 .NET CLI 库。
使用 NuGet 包管理器控制台
Install-Package GroupDocs.Conversion -Version 25.3.0
使用 .N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
许可证获取步骤:
- 免费试用: 访问试用版 GroupDocs 免费试用.
- 临时执照: 申请临时驾照 GroupDocs 临时许可证页面.
- 购买: 如需长期使用,请直接从 GroupDocs 购买页面.
基本初始化和设置
以下是如何在 C# 项目中初始化和设置 GroupDocs.Conversion:
using GroupDocs.Conversion;
// 使用源文件路径初始化转换器。
var converter = new Converter("YOUR_DOCUMENT_DIRECTORY\\sample.ppsm");
实施指南
一切设置完毕后,让我们逐步实施转换过程。
加载 PPSM 并将其转换为 TEX
概述
在本节中,我们将演示如何加载 PPSM 文件并将其转换为 LaTeX 文档格式 (.tex)。
步骤 1:定义源和输出路径
string sourceFilePath = @"YOUR_DOCUMENT_DIRECTORY\sample.ppsm";
string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"ppsm-converted-to.tex");
步骤 2:设置 TEX 格式的转换选项
设置转换选项以指定目标格式为 LaTeX (TEX)。
PageDescriptionLanguageConvertOptions options = new PageDescriptionLanguageConvertOptions {
Format = GroupDocs.Conversion.FileTypes.PageDescriptionLanguageFileType.Tex
};
步骤3:执行转换过程
现在,使用指定的选项执行转换并保存结果。
using (var converter = new Converter(sourceFilePath))
{
// 将 PPSM 转换为 TEX 格式。
converter.Convert(outputFile, options);
}
故障排除提示:
- 确保所有路径均已正确设置且可访问。
- 验证您是否具有从源目录读取和写入输出目录的适当权限。
实际应用
将 PPSM 文件转换为 TEX 可以在以下几种实际场景中发挥作用:
- 学术研究: 将演示幻灯片无缝集成到研究论文或毕业论文文档中。
- 技术文档: 将幻灯片转换为 LaTeX 格式的综合技术手册,以便进行精确排版。
- 出版准备: 使用 LaTeX 准备需要详细格式和数学表达式的出版物。
性能考虑
使用 GroupDocs.Conversion 时,请考虑以下提示以优化性能:
- 通过批量转换文件而不是单独转换文件来最大限度地减少资源使用。
- 通过在使用后及时处置对象来有效地管理内存。
- 遵循 .NET 内存管理的最佳实践,确保垃圾收集不会不必要地延迟。
结论
恭喜!您已经学会了如何使用 GroupDocs.Conversion for .NET 将 PPSM 文件转换为 TEX 文件。此过程可以简化您处理演示文稿和 LaTeX 文档时的工作流程。
为了进一步探索,考虑深入研究 GroupDocs 文档 或尝试 GroupDocs 支持的其他文件格式。
后续步骤:
- 探索其他转换功能
- 将此功能集成到更大的 .NET 应用程序中
常见问题解答部分
- 我可以使用 GroupDocs.Conversion 将其他 Microsoft Office 文件转换为 TEX 吗?
- 是的,GroupDocs.Conversion 支持多种文档格式的转换。
- 如果我的 PPSM 文件太大而无法转换怎么办?
- 确保您有足够的系统资源或考虑单独转换较小的部分。
- 如何解决转换过程中的错误?
- 检查错误日志并确保所有路径正确;另外,验证 GroupDocs.Conversion 库是否正确安装。
- 是否支持将多个 PPSM 文件批量转换为 TEX?
- 是的,您可以循环遍历 PPSM 文件目录并按顺序转换每个文件。
- 我可以进一步自定义输出 TEX 格式吗?
- GroupDocs.Conversion 允许自定义选项;请参阅 API 文档 了解更多详情。
资源
- 文档: GroupDocs 转换文档
- API 参考: GroupDocs API 参考
- 下载: 最新版本
- 购买: 购买 GroupDocs 产品
- 免费试用: 尝试免费试用
- 临时执照: 申请临时执照
- 支持: GroupDocs 支持论坛
立即开始转换并将您的文档管理提升到新的水平!